
CAS 398119-27-2
:3-bromo-5-formylbenzoic acid
Description:
3-Bromo-5-formylbenzoic acid is an aromatic compound characterized by the presence of a bromine atom, a formyl group, and a carboxylic acid functional group attached to a benzene ring. The bromine substituent is located at the meta position relative to the carboxylic acid group, while the formyl group is positioned at the para location. This compound typically exhibits properties associated with both aromatic compounds and carboxylic acids, such as acidity due to the carboxyl group and potential reactivity due to the electrophilic nature of the formyl group. It is likely to be a solid at room temperature and may be soluble in polar organic solvents. The presence of the bromine atom can influence the compound's reactivity, making it a useful intermediate in organic synthesis, particularly in the preparation of more complex molecules. Additionally, the compound may exhibit specific spectral characteristics in techniques such as NMR and IR spectroscopy, which can be utilized for its identification and characterization in laboratory settings.
